With a 45% haze factor, it ensures diffuse and homogeneous lighting that optimizes the growth of plants in horticultural greenhouses.
This solution was jointly developed by ARDC (Avilés Research & Development Center) for its prismatic texture, the CRDC (Chantereine Research & Development Center) for its anti-reflective coatings and by SGR (Saint-Gobain Research) for modelling its optical properties.
The Mannheim plant makes the primary SGG ALBARINO MID HAZE glass, as well as the finished glass, cut, shaped, given an anti-reflective coating and tempered, ready to be installed on greenhouse roofs.
